  • Online therapy works very much like in-person therapy, just from the comfort of your own space. We’ll meet through a secure, confidential video platform, using a link I’ll provide before each session. You’ll need a private space, a stable internet connection, and a phone, tablet, or computer with a camera and microphone.

    Many clients find online therapy to be just as effective as in-person sessions and even more convenient. It allows for flexibility, saves travel time, and makes it easier to fit therapy into your daily life.

  • I do not accept insurance, and here's why: Working outside of insurance gives us the freedom to tailor your care to what works best for you, not just what fits into a 50-minute box. This flexibility means we can schedule shorter check-ins when you need a boost or longer sessions (like EMDR intensives) when you’re ready to go deeper. I’m happy to provide a superbill upon request, which you can submit to your insurance company for potential out-of-network reimbursement.
